Warriors, Kings, and Gods

In Sons of Thunder by Giles Kristian, we are transported back to the ninth century, a time of brutal wars, fierce loyalties, and the clash of cultures. The story follows Raven, a young Norse warrior, and his companions as they embark on a perilous journey to fulfill their destiny.

Raven is a complex character, haunted by his past and driven by a deep sense of duty. He is accompanied by the enigmatic monk, Father Cuthbert, a man of faith and learning, who is not as helpless as he first appears. Together, they are on a quest to retrieve a mysterious book, a powerful relic that could alter the course of history.

A Clash of Cultures

Their journey takes them across the treacherous seas and into the heart of Frankia, a land ruled by Charlemagne's descendants. Here, they encounter a world vastly different from their own, a world of walled cities, Christian monasteries, and powerful kings. The clash of Norse and Frankish cultures is vividly depicted, highlighting the misunderstandings, prejudices, and brutal violence that often accompany such encounters.

Despite the cultural barriers, Raven and his crew find allies among the Franks, forming unlikely friendships and alliances. They also face formidable enemies, including the ruthless Count Odo, whose thirst for power threatens to plunge the entire region into chaos.

The Power of Legends

As they journey deeper into Frankia, Raven and Father Cuthbert become embroiled in a complex web of politics, power struggles, and ancient prophecies. They encounter a mysterious group known as the Sons of Thunder, a band of warriors who believe in the power of the old gods and seek to reclaim their land from the Christian Franks.

Legends and myths play a significant role in the story, shaping the characters' actions and beliefs. The Norsemen, with their belief in fate and their own pantheon of gods, clash with the Christian Franks, who are equally steeped in their own religious beliefs and traditions. Kristian deftly weaves these contrasting worldviews into the narrative, adding depth and complexity to the characters and their motivations.

A Hero's Journey

As the story unfolds, Raven is forced to confront his own past and the dark secrets that have shaped him. He must also come to terms with his destiny and the role he is meant to play in the unfolding conflict. The monk, Father Cuthbert, also undergoes his own transformation, questioning his faith and his place in a world torn apart by violence and power struggles.

In the climactic battle, Raven and his crew must make a fateful choice that will determine the fate of Frankia. Their decision not only tests their loyalty to each other but also their beliefs and values. In the end, Sons of Thunder is a gripping tale of adventure, friendship, and the enduring power of legends, set against the backdrop of a tumultuous historical period.
